Reporting to the Head of Treasury & Banking, Finance Administrator role is responsible for the coordination of all Cash Management activities related to cash, credit card and gift card reconciliation as well as other related tasks across multiple brands.
**What you will do in this role**:
- Daily bank reconciliation related to cash & credit cards
- Daily reports and file uploads into reconciliation system
- Communication with bank, credit card companies, restaurants and internal departments on an ongoing basis for inquiries and to resolve discrepancies
- Weekly booking of journal entries
- Month-end activities with tight deadlines
- Monthly and Quarterly reconciliation & analysis of Gift Card liability
- New location/Franchised/Closed locations banking set up administration
- Backup to other Finance Administrators within Banking Department
- Other banking duties, as required
